Output 90af587ec8d9bdf4815b2106159388a8d76f632cc0442a029715664b38d85ced:0

value
186986
script pubkey
OP_0 OP_PUSHBYTES_20 6cbc24a1a9a0c9a3d50695a5ee60e25e9ed535d2
address
bc1qdj7zfgdf5ry684gxjkj7uc8zt60d2dwjleaf4e
transaction
90af587ec8d9bdf4815b2106159388a8d76f632cc0442a029715664b38d85ced
confirmations
67708
spent
true